The New American

A news and opinion journal that offers a right-wing perspective on political science, social opinion, and economic theory issues. Topics addressed include constitutional conservatism, economic libertarianism, and the behind-the-scenes forces shaping American politics and culture. The magazine is published by a subsidiary of the John Birch Society.
